The Pittston Area Primary Center’s Averie Klush, first grade, and Cara Welby, kindergarten, were named winners of the AMVETS Post No. 189 Americanism Contest, which is offered for teaching students in grades kindergarten through 12th grade about American heritage, civics and citizenship. The program includes flag drawing, poster and essay contest that are grade specific and age appropriate. In photo, from left, first row, Klush and Welby.
